Given : A sine function has the following key features:
Frequency = [tex]\frac{1}{8\pi}[/tex], Amplitude = 6, Midline: y = 3, y-intercept: (0,3)
The function is not a reflection of its parent function over the x-axis.
To plot the graph :
Solution :
General form of sin function is [tex]y=A sin(Bx)+C[/tex]
Where A is the amplitude
[tex]B=\frac{2\pi}{\text{Period}}[/tex]
C is the midline
Substitute the given key features,
A=6 , C=3
Period= 1/Frequency
[tex]P=8\pi[/tex]
[tex]B=\frac{2\pi}{8\pi}=\frac{1}{4}[/tex]
The sin function is [tex]y=6sin(\frac{1}{4}x)+3[/tex]
